Giriak
Giriak is a Town and Subdivision in Nalanda District of Bihar. In India, a subdivision is a sub-division of a district that is responsible for the administration and revenue collection of a particular area within the district. It is an important part of the local governance structure, and plays a crucial role in the development and administration of its local community.
According to Census 2011, the sub-district code of Giriak Block (CD) is 01396. The total area of Giriak Subdivision is 80 km². Giriak has a sex ratio of approximately 932 females per 1,000 males.

Population of Giriak Subdivision
The population profile of Giriak Subdivision offers a deeper understanding of how people are settled across its rural and urban parts. The following sections provide key insights into total population, household distribution, literacy, and age demographics — data that plays a vital role in planning development work and allocating public resources effectively.
Basic Population Details
This section offers a snapshot of Giriak Subdivision's population composition, including male-female ratio, child population, and how literacy levels vary between villages and towns.
Particulars | Total | Rural | Urban |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 96,845 | 96,845 | N/A |
Male Population | 50,124 | 50,124 | N/A |
Female Population | 46,721 | 46,721 | N/A |
Child Population (Age 0–6) | 17,959 | 17,959 | N/A |
Male Child Population (Age 0–6) | 9,318 | 9,318 | N/A |
Female Child Population (Age 0–6) | 8,641 | 8,641 | N/A |
Literate Population | 48,123 | 48,123 | N/A |
Literate Male Population | 29,198 | 29,198 | N/A |
Literate Female Population | 18,925 | 18,925 | N/A |
Illiterate Population | 48,722 | 48,722 | N/A |
Illiterate Male Population | 20,926 | 20,926 | N/A |
Illiterate Female Population | 27,796 | 27,796 | N/A |
Total Households | 15,584 | 15,584 | N/A |
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:
- Total population is approximately 96,845 people. Includes nearly 50,124 males and 46,721 females. Rural population is about 96,845 people.
- There are around 17,959 children aged 0 to 6 years. This includes approximately 9,318 boys and 8,641 girls.
- Literate population is about 48,123 people. Non-literate population is around 48,722 people.
- There are nearly 15,584 households.
Social Structure and Density
This section offers a snapshot of social structure in Giriak Subdivision, highlighting the SC and ST population across rural and urban areas, as well as how densely people live in different parts of the region.
Particulars | Total | Rural | Urban |
---|---|---|---|
Total SC Population | 22,152 | 22,152 | N/A |
SC Male Population | 11,317 | 11,317 | N/A |
SC Female Population | 10,835 | 10,835 | N/A |
Total ST Population | 93 | 93 | N/A |
ST Male Population | 50 | 50 | N/A |
ST Female Population | 43 | 43 | N/A |
Population Density | 1,205 / km² | 1,205 / km² | N/A |
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:
- Scheduled Caste (SC) population in Giriak Subdivision is approximately 22,152 people, including 11,317 males and 10,835 females. Around 22,152 people live in rural parts.
- Scheduled Tribe (ST) population in Giriak Subdivision is about 93 people, including 50 males and 43 females. Around 93 live in villages or rural parts.
- In terms of density, overall population density is around 1,205 people per square kilometre, rural areas have about 1,205 people per sq. km.
